Metallic Smell In Nose, Have Impaired Smelling Sense, History Of Extensive Bridge Work With Implants. Could Implants Be The Reason?

I am smelling metal in my nose . I do not feel nauseated. It seems to have built up a little more. I had extensive bridge work including implants two years ago. Now I have never felt completely unaffected by the procedure and it took close to a year but I know that I do not enjoy the smell of things as I did years ago. However, I am approaching 50 next year and I do know that the sensation of smell decreases over time. The smell, smells a little like what I remember of the cement used. My concern is that over the last 4 months it seems to have increased. I am wondering if it could be the implants or if this points to a stranger scenario. This is the only symptom.

ENT Specialist 's  Response
Dear Dietregau,
Smell sensation usually does not come down with age unless you have other systemic problems. In regard to your above mentioned complaints, i would suggest you go for a CT scan of the nose and sinuses to rule out any retained foreign body/polyps in sinuses.
Its a better idea to consult a nearby ENT specialist.
